π Creating a Sustainable Garden
To create a sustainable garden, consider the following steps:
- Choose Native Plants: Select plants that are well-adapted to your local climate and soil.
- Use Organic Practices: Implement organic gardening techniques to minimize chemical use.
- Implement Water-Saving Techniques: Utilize drip irrigation or rainwater collection to conserve water.
By following these steps, you can cultivate a garden that is not only beautiful but also environmentally friendly.
